Abstract
Cysteamine is known to deplete somatostatin from pancreatic D cells. I n the isolated perfused rat pancreas we investigated its effects on so matostatin and glucagon release as well as exocrine pancreatic secreti on in the presence of 1.8 mM glucose. Cysteamine, 10 mM, released soma tostatin, but had no effect on CCK-stimulated amylase secretion. Argin ine-stimulated glucagon release, however, was significantly inhibited by cysteamine. Concomitantly we still observed stimulation of somatost atin secretion, but also a potentiation of CCK-stimulated amylase secr etion. Our results are consistent with a role of somatostatin in the r egulation of exocrine pancreatic secretion via its effect on pancreati c A and B cells.
